Output 66c2106d1d0ed64bf604614498a8cd1c1883788c32e9d7757c07adc3ab5a3af7:0

value
3190191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7ebe7154a5c9eadb498fd5af49ac8be2254eef5 OP_EQUAL
address
3Kv6zXGrvqYkbMicTh1DXBgWkqWP9orNJa
transaction
66c2106d1d0ed64bf604614498a8cd1c1883788c32e9d7757c07adc3ab5a3af7
spent
false